High School Mentor Program

Promoting College Going Access to San Marcos High School Students and Parents

The prospect of applying for college and financial aid can be daunting for high school students approaching graduation. But at San Marcos High School, help is available from Texas State University (TXST) students with their own recent experiences of transitioning from high school to college through the work study mentorship program (WSMP).

Student Mentors Making College Possible

The program is designed to improve student access to higher education by utilizing student mentors who counsel high school students about the college admission process and supporting interventions that increase the completion of degrees or certificates.
